"You have a straightforward choice," Maggie Smith's Dowager Countess tells granddaughter Lady Mary Crawley. "You must choose. Either death, or life." "And you think I should choose life," Lady Mary responds, still grief-stricken over the loss of her husband Matthew late last season.

It's pretty clear that, eventually, Lady Mary will have to choose life. She's got a new baby, a television show to help carry, and the roaring twenties in front of her. The rest of the trailer embraces the optimism of the period,* promising new romances for the heartbroken, dancing, some great fashion, and some actual characters of color.
